    A Day at the Races... In Brooklyn
    Yesterday was the Brooklyn Half Marathon. It started in Prospect Park and made 2 loops around the park before exiting and getting on to Ocean Parkway at the 7 mile. From there it was straight to Coney Island where the race finished on the boardwalk near Keyspan Park. Approximately 12,000 people entered the race, and 9,415 people finished within the three hour time limit.

    I was aiming for a pace between 7:30 and 7:45 per mile and ended up with a 7:33 pace for the day finishing in 1:39:07, ten minutes faster than my time for the Manhattan Half. While not my best pace ever, it is a half marathon PR for me.

    Team Giraffes had a good showing. Four of the seven runners we entered finished in under 2 hours, and all finished in under 2:30. Four members of the team have completed their qualifiers for the 2010 NYC Marathon now, and another is one race away from completion.
